KCGM is now recruiting for an experienced Underground Shift Supervisor to join and lead the production team of the Mt Charlotte underground operation.

These residential roles are on an even time 7 days / 7 off / 7 nights / 7 off (12 hr shifts) roster.

Reporting to the Underground Production Superintendent, the underground shift supervisor will be responsible for coordinating and supervising underground production personnel and activities, ensuring all key targets are achieved in a safe and cost effective timely manner. People management and positive, pro-active leadership are key criteria for this position.

Requirements

Essential

  • A minimum five (5) years underground mining experience
  • A minimum two (2) years experience in a supervisory role in a similarly sized operation or at foreman level within a larger operation.
  • Demonstrated ability to react and diagnose problems to accurately identify and implement potential solutions in a timely manner.
  • Highly developed interpersonal skills enabling liaison at all levels of the underground operation.
  • Experience in coaching and performance management of team members to enhance team effectiveness.
  • West Australian Shift Supervisors Certificate of Competency
  • Intermediate level of computer skills.
  • Dangerous Goods Clearance Card
  • First Aid Certificate
  • National Police Clearance less than twelve (12) months old
  • Current Unencumbered Western Australian C Class Drivers Licence.

Preferred

  • Formal leadership / supervisory qualifications
  • West Australian Shotfirer’s Ticket.
